How Solar Panels Generate Electrical Energy



Solar panels harness the sun's power by transforming sunshine right into electrical energy via a process referred to as the solar result. When sunlight strikes the solar panels, the photons (light fragments) are absorbed by the semiconducting products within the panels, typically made from silicon. This absorption creates an electric existing as the photons knock electrons loosened from the atoms within the product.

The electrical fields within the solar batteries then force these electrons to stream in a details direction, producing a straight current (DC) of electrical power. This straight current is after that gone through an inverter, which transforms it into alternating existing (AIR CONDITIONING) electricity that can be used to power your home or business.

Excess electrical power created by the solar panels can be stored in batteries for later usage or fed back into the grid for credit score with a process called net metering. Comprehending Solar Panel Components



One crucial facet of photovoltaic panel innovation is understanding the different components that comprise a photovoltaic panel system.

The essential parts of a photovoltaic panel system consist of the photovoltaic panels themselves, which are composed of solar batteries that convert sunlight right into power. These panels are placed on a framework, often a roof covering, to catch sunlight.

Along with the panels, there are inverters that transform the direct current (DC) electricity created by the panels right into alternating existing (AIR CONDITIONER) electrical power that can be made use of in homes or organizations.

The system also includes racking to sustain and place the solar panels for ideal sunlight exposure. Additionally, cables and ports are essential for moving the electrical energy produced by the panels to the electrical system of a structure.

Lastly, a monitoring system may be included to track the efficiency of the solar panel system and ensure it's working effectively. Understanding these components is vital for anybody aiming to install or make use of photovoltaic panel technology successfully.
